The 2ZZ-GE is a 1.8 L (1796 cc or 109.6 in³) version built in Japan. Bore is 82 mm (3.23") and the stroke is 85 mm (3.35"). It uses MFI fuel injection, has VVTL-i, and features forged steel connecting rods. Compression ratio is 11.5:1, necessitating "premium" gasoline (95..octane or above in the (R+M)/2 scale used in North America[5]). Power output for this engine varies depending on the vehicle and tuning, with the Celica GT-S, Corolla T-Sport,[6][7] Lotus Elise and Lotus Exige offering 141 kW (189 hp) but the American versions of the 2003 Matrix, and Pontiac Vibe versions only developing 180 hp[5] with all later years offering anywhere from 173 hp in 2004 to 164 hp in 2006 due to a recurved powerband. The differing power figures from 2004 through 2006 are due to changes in dynamometer testing procedures. The Australian variant Corolla Sportivo has 141 kW@7600 and 181N·m torque. Due to noise regulations, Toyota recalled them for a flash of the PCM to up their output to classify them in the more lenient "sports car" noise category. The Corolla Compressor and Lotus Exige S add a supercharger with intercooler to achieve 225 hp (168 kW), while the Exige 240R's supercharger increases output to 240 hp (179 kW). The addition of a non-intercooled supercharger to the Elise SC produces 218 hp (163 kW) with a considerable weight saving. The supercharged engines are not labeled 2ZZ-GZE.
Unique to the ZZ family, the 2ZZ-GE utilizes a dual camshaft profile system (the "L" in VVTL-i, known by enthusiasts and engineers alike as "lift") to produce the added power without an increase in displacement or forced induction. The 2ZZ-GE was the first production engine to combine cam-phasing variable valve timing with dual-profile variable valve timing in the American market.
